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Scandalously Bound To The Gentleman - Helen Dickson A moment of abandon...leads to a scandal! Lucy Quinn has never put much stock in what others think. After the traumatic events of her past, she avoids society, working as a nurse in India. Then she meets British diplomat Charles Anderson, who makes her feel a lightness and excitement again. Until his inevitable return to England, and the discovery their liaison has consequences. Now Lucy must face the Ton once more and tell Charles he's a father! Alliance With The Notorious Lord - Bronwyn Scott Mixing business...with rakish pleasure! Recently widowed Antonia Lytton-Popplewell is determined to carve her place in a man's world. Yet turning a ramshackle property in London into a worldclass department store isn't easy. Especially when her inheritance comes with strings in the form of her late husband's business partner, infuriatingly attractive Lord Cullen Allardyce. To ensure success, Antonia needs Cullen's guidance. But her alliance with society's most notorious rebel becomes even more complicated when begrudging respect turns into mutual desire...
